Measuring height and weight for a supine patient patients who are not able to stand will need to have their height and weight measured while they remain in bed.
Cna essential skills. Measure and record weight. Describe the proper use of an overbed scale. If a patient cannot be raised or cannot stand up due to some physical condition the health care worker will have to measure it while the patient is lying down with the help of a fellow nurse aide.
